Street corner house just round the corner from Woolwich Arsenal railway station. The pub was given a facelift at the beginning of 2015 with 3 handpumps installed. There are three real ales available, usually nationally known brands. Despite historical signage to the contrary, food is not currently served. The single bar area is kept spotless with its wooden floor immaculately varnished and polished.
